Well folks, here is my best first attempt at the second 1600's document
found in a garage in suburban Melbourne, Australia by my brother-in-law:-

1st Sept 1685

BEE IT knowne that --------- (?) Dame Sarah SPRING widdow relict of Sir
William SPRING late of Pakenham in the County of Suffolk BaronÂ’t died in
?suance (?) of the trust reposed in her by the said Sir William SPRING in
and by the last will ----- (?) bearing the date the sixth day of October
Anno (?) Lord One Thousand six hundred and eighty ------- (?) at and by the
direction of Dame Anne ROBINSON widdow sold and conveyed to William
WILLIAMS of the Citty of Qbesum- (?) in the County of Midx Esquire And John
COATES of Clements Greene in the said County of Midx ---- And Ralph GRANGE
of the Guner (?) Temple S----- ----- and their ------ All that the ---
Mannor of ----field Hall with the appended Commons (?) other ------- in the
County of Suffolk. And whe------- ---------- presentation and right of
Pakenham of the Parish Church of Cockfield in the said County of Suffolk
---- ---- ---- Mannor aforesaid ---- do to supposed bee Comprehended ----
general Conveyance of the Mannor aforesaid ---- ----ngon ----- of
P--------- and ----- ----- (crease in document) ----- nor is intended to be
Conveyed or passed by any General words in the said Conveyance or
otherwise. IT IS therefore ?declared and agreed by and between the said
William WILLIAMS, John COATES and Ralph GRAINGE and the said Dame Sarah
SPRING with the pribity (?) and consent of the said Dame Anne ROBINSON that
in case Sir Thomas SPRING (now an infant) sonne and heire of the said Sir
William SPRING or any other right heire of the said Sir William SPRING soe
soone as by the attainment of the age of One and Twenty yeares or otherwise
the ------ they shall be capable soe to doe shall be good assurance in the
Law as the Councell Learned in the Law of the said William WILLIAMS, John
COATES and Ralph GRAINGE shall reasonably ----ise well and sussinently (?)
at the request ----- and Charges in the law of the said William WILLIAMS,
John COATES and Ralph GRAINGE their heires or assigns convey assure and
confirme unto the said William WILLIAMS, John COATES and Ralph GRAINGE and
their heires To the use of the said William WILLIAMS, John COATES and Ralph
GRAINGE and their heires the said Mannor of Cockfield and all and every the
Mannors lands tenements and hereditainments which in and by one
Gno-------(?) Tripartite bearing --- date herewith made or mentioned to be
made between the said Dame Sarah SPRING of the first part, the said Dame
Anne ROBINSON relict of Sir Lumley ROBINSON Baronet deceased of the second
part and the said William WILLIAMS, John COATES and Ralph GRAINGE of the
third part are bargained and sold or mentioned to be bargained and sold by
the said Dame Sarah SPRING to the said William WILLIAMS, John COATES and
Ralph GRAINGE and their heires The said Avowson and right of Patronage and
presentation onely------- That then and thereupon the said William
WILLIAMS, John COATES and Ralph GRAINGE their heires and assigns shall and
will at the request to do and Charged in the law of the said Sir Thomas
SPRING or any other the heir of the said Sir William SPRING well and
sufficiently Convey and assure the said Avowson right of Patronage and
Presentation of the Church aforesaid unto the said Sir Thomas SPRING or any
other the heires of the said Sir William SPRING--- and their heires.
Discharged of all encumbrancesÂ’ done or willingly suffered by them the said
William WILLIAMS, John COATES and Ralph GRAINGE any or either of them in
any wise And in the meanetime shall the said Sir Thomas SPRING or some
other heire of the said Sir William SPRING shall assign (?) his or their
dues (?) of One and Twenty years Shall and will hold the said Avowson ----
for the said Sir Thomas SPRING his heirs or Assigns or forsuch of -------
as shall be their --- Law to the said Sir William SPRING and his heires to
be disposed of as fit (?) or they shall appoint. IN WITNESSE whereof the
said Dame Anne ROBINSON, William WILLIAMS, John COATES and Ralph GRAINGE
have hereto sett their hands and sealed this first day of September in the
first yeare of the reign of our Sovereign Lord James the ------- of
England, Scotland France (?) and Ireland, King Defender of the Faith. And
in the grace of our Lord Christ One Thousand six hundres and Eighty and
five.

Signed:-
William WILLIAMS John COATES Ralph GRAINGE

And on the reverse:-

Sealed and delivered by the within William WILLIAMS in the presence of:-

Wm KINGSTON
Nm PEACHEY
E--- PAGE (?)

Sealed and delivered by the within named John COATES andRalph GRAINGE in
the presence of:-

John BRYAN
Edw TURNER
John OLIVER
Nath : PHILLIPS
